topotests: add bgp duplicate nexthop test
Add a topotest that ensures that when addpath is enabled and two paths with same nexthop are received, they are sent to ZEBRA which detects 'duplicate nexthop'. Signed-off-by: Philippe Guibert <philippe.guibert@6wind.com>

diff --git a/tests/topotests/bgp_duplicate_nexthop/test_bgp_duplicate_nexthop.py b/tests/topotests/bgp_duplicate_nexthop/test_bgp_duplicate_nexthop.py
new file mode 100644
index 0000000000..955881e6f9
--- /dev/null
+++ b/tests/topotests/bgp_duplicate_nexthop/test_bgp_duplicate_nexthop.py
@@ -0,0 +1,458 @@
+#!/usr/bin/env python
+# SPDX-License-Identifier: ISC
+
+#
+# test_bgp_duplicate_nexthop.py
+#
+# Copyright 2024 6WIND S.A.
+#
+
+"""
+ test_bgp_nhg_duplicate_nexthop.py:
+ Check that the FRR BGP daemon on r1 selects updates with same nexthops
+
+
++---+----+ +---+----+ +--------+
+| | | + | |
+| r1 +----------+ r3 +----------+ r5 +
+| | | rr + +-----+ |
++++-+----+ +--------+\ / +--------+
+ | \/
+ | /\
+ | +--------+/ \ +--------+
+ | | + +-----+ +
+ +---------------+ r4 +----------+ r6 +
+ | | | |
+ +--------+ +--------+
+"""

+def test_bgp_ipv4_convergence():
+ """
+ Check that R1 has received the 192.0.2.9/32 prefix from R5, and R6
+ """
+ tgen = get_topogen()
+ if tgen.routers_have_failure():
+ pytest.skip(tgen.errors)
+
+ logger.info("Ensure that the 192.0.2.9/32 route is available")
+ check_ipv4_prefix_with_multiple_nexthops("192.0.2.9/32")
+
+ check_ipv4_prefix_with_multiple_nexthops_linux("192.0.2.9")
+
+
+def test_bgp_ipv4_recursive_routes():
+ """
+ Check that R1 has received the recursive routes, and duplicate nexthops are in zebra, but are not installed
+ """
+ tgen = get_topogen()
+ if tgen.routers_have_failure():
+ pytest.skip(tgen.errors)
+
+ check_ipv4_prefix_recursive_with_multiple_nexthops("192.0.2.8/32", "192.0.2.9")
+
+ check_ipv4_prefix_with_multiple_nexthops_linux("192.0.2.8")
+
+
+def test_bgp_ipv4_recursive_routes_when_no_mpath():
+ """
+ Unconfigure multipath ibgp
+ Check that duplicate nexthops are not in zebra
+ """
+ tgen = get_topogen()
+ if tgen.routers_have_failure():
+ pytest.skip(tgen.errors)
+
+ tgen.gears["r1"].vtysh_cmd(
+ """
+ configure terminal
+ router bgp
+ address family ipv4 unicast
+ maximum-paths ibgp 1
+ """,
+ isjson=False,
+ )
+ tgen.gears["r1"].vtysh_cmd("clear bgp ipv4 *")
+ check_ipv4_prefix_with_multiple_nexthops("192.0.2.9/32", multipath=False)
+
+ check_ipv4_prefix_recursive_with_multiple_nexthops(
+ "192.0.2.8/32", "192.0.2.9", multipath=False
+ )
+
